The Importance Of Potato Supply For Sustaining Global Food Security

Potatoes are one of the most widely consumed staple foods in the world, with over 1.5 billion people relying on them for sustenance. With their versatility, affordability, and nutritional value, potatoes play a crucial role in providing food security for people across the globe. However, ensuring a steady and reliable potato supply is essential to sustain this vital source of nutrition.

The potato supply chain involves a complex network of farmers, distributors, processors, and retailers working together to produce and deliver potatoes to consumers. Factors such as climate change, pests and diseases, transportation challenges, and market dynamics can all impact the potato supply chain, leading to fluctuations in availability and pricing. Therefore, it is crucial to effectively manage the potato supply chain to ensure a consistent and stable flow of potatoes to meet the demands of consumers.

One of the key challenges facing the potato supply chain is climate change. Rising temperatures, changing precipitation patterns, and extreme weather events can all affect potato production by reducing yields, altering growing conditions, and increasing susceptibility to pests and diseases. In regions where potatoes are a staple crop, such as parts of Africa, Asia, and Latin America, climate change poses a significant threat to food security. By implementing sustainable farming practices, utilizing new technologies, and developing climate-resilient potato varieties, farmers can adapt to changing environmental conditions and safeguard the potato supply for future generations.

Pests and diseases are another major concern for the potato supply chain. Common potato pests such as aphids, potato beetles, and nematodes can reduce yields and quality, leading to shortages in the potato supply. Plant diseases like late blight, early blight, and potato virus Y can also devastate potato crops, resulting in significant losses for farmers and impacting the availability of potatoes for consumers. Integrated pest management strategies, disease-resistant potato varieties, and biosecurity measures are essential to protect potato crops from pests and diseases and maintain a reliable potato supply.

Transportation challenges can also disrupt the potato supply chain. Potatoes are a perishable commodity that requires careful handling and storage to prevent spoilage and maintain quality. Lack of adequate infrastructure, inefficient logistics, and poor road conditions can lead to delays in transporting potatoes from farms to markets, resulting in shortages and price volatility. Investing in improved transportation systems, cold storage facilities, and refrigerated trucks can help ensure the timely and efficient delivery of potatoes and minimize losses along the supply chain.

Market dynamics play a significant role in shaping the potato supply chain. Fluctuations in demand, changes in consumer preferences, and global trade policies can all influence the availability and pricing of potatoes. Market volatility can lead to price spikes, supply shortages, and food insecurity for vulnerable populations who rely on potatoes as a primary source of nutrition. Strengthening market linkages, promoting fair trade practices, and enhancing access to information can help stabilize the potato supply chain and ensure that potatoes remain affordable and accessible for all.
